网站大量收购独家精品文档,联系QQ:2885784924

OrientStore+一种支持高效更新的Native+XML存储方法.pdf

OrientStore+一种支持高效更新的Native+XML存储方法.pdf

  1. 1、本文档共8页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
OrientStore一种支持高效更新的NativeXML存储方法

计算机研究与发展 Journal of Computer Research and Development ISSN 1000.1239|CN 11.1777|TP 44(Suppl.):368~373,2007 OrientStore+:一种支持高效更新的Native XML存储方法 张 新 孟小峰 朱金清 王 伟 黄 静 (中国人民大学信息学院北京100872) (xinzhang@File.edu.cn) OrientStore+:A Native XML Storage Strategy for Efficient Update Zhang Xin,Meng Xiaofeng,Zhu Jinqing,Wang Wei,and Huang Jing (School of Information,Renmin University of China,Beijing 100872) Abstract The storage strategy for XML data in database will affect the efficiency of querying,indexing and updating significantly.The cost is high for most of state—of—the—art XML storage strategies when considering update.In this paper,an optimized native XML storage strategy,called OrientStore+,is proposed,which can keep the structure relationship between nodes completely and the new storage can also satisfy the following virtues:1)it can facilitate building index on XML data;2)the records in the storage are independent,which can reduce the modification of the storage data and index after update,reducing the update cost;and 3)the storage strategy is implemented in native XML database system OrientX.In this paper,a new update algorithm which is based on the space usage ratio,is proposed.Finally,the efficiency of query and update using different storage strategies is compared through extensive experiments. Key words XML database;XML storage;XML update 摘要XML数据在数据库中的存储模式对XML数据的查询、索引及更新有重要的影响.而目前许多 XML存储方法在更新上都需要较高的代价.提出一种Native XML存储方法OrientStore+,可以完全保 留XML树结构信息,同时还具有如下特点:1)易于对XML数据建立各种索引;2)存储记录间相互独 立,进行更新时,可以减少对XML存储及索引的修改,减小了更新的代价;3)在Native XML数据库系 统OrientX中实现了这种存储模式.另外,在这种存储模式基础上提出一种基于空间利用率的XML存 储更新算法.并通过实验比较了在不同存储方法上的查询与更新效率. 关键词XML数据库;XML存储;XML更新 中圈法分类号TP391 目前已有许多XML数据库系统【14 J来管理 XML数据,根据管理XML数据方式,将这些数据 库分为两类:Native XML数据库【1-2J和非Native XML数据库L5J,前者对XML数据的管理建立在 XML数据模型L6j上,而后者是将XML数据模型映 射到其他数据模型上,如关系模型【4J.由于XMIe数 据的半结构化特点,映射到其他数据模型往往会使 问题变得复杂.因此,一些传统关系数据库厂商开 始在关系数据库上采用Native方式管理XML数 据L3J.本文讨论的工作也是如何在Native方式下有 效地实现XML的存储与更新. XML数据模型是把XML文档看成一棵由不 同结点组成的树,称之为文档树.为了能随机访问 或者修

文档评论(0)

l215322 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档